Methodology: How We Ranked the Best Solar Companies in San Dimas

EcoWatch's solar experts analyzed each solar company in San Dimas based on criteria such as its reputation in the industry, customer reviews, services, warranty coverage and financing. Using this solar methodology, we used the data we collected to rate and rank each company and narrow down our picks for the best solar companies in San Dimas


Below are some the criteria we examined specifically for California solar companies

  • Brand reputation and certifications (20%): We take each company's Better Business Bureau (BBB) score into consideration, as well as how long the installer has been in business (at least 5 years is required, 10 preferred) and what type of solar certifications it holds.
  • Customer reviews (20%): Trust is a top priority at EcoWatch, so we take customer experience under close consideration. We scour different review sites and customer testimonials when ranking our top solar companies, checking sites such as Trustpilot and Google Reviews. We also consider any potential complaints or lawsuits filed against these companies and award or remove points accordingly.
  • Warranty (20%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ers 25-year warranties that cover performance, product and workmanship. The industry standard that we measure companies against is 25-year product and performance warranties, along with a 10-year workmanship warranty. We also look closely into the track record of the post-installation support each company provides in terms of honoring its contracts
  • Solar services (10%): All of the companies we review install solar panels, but we award companies higher points if they offer additional services for customers, like battery installation, energy-efficiency audits, and EV chargers.
  • Pricing and financing (10%): It's hard to get exact quotes for solar projects, but we use marketplace research to determine how each company prices its equipment and installation services. Additionally, companies that offer more help for panel financing — like in-house loans, leases, or PPAs — score higher than those that don't.
  • Availability (10%): The bigger the service area, the higher the company will score.
  • Transparency and accessibility (5%): Solar installers that offer free consultations and easy contact methods score higher in this category.
  • Environmental, social and corporate governance factors (5%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ers public data disclosure, addresses end-of-life (EOL) products or processes, and demonstrates a commitment to uplifting the communities that it serves.

The Cost and Benefits of Solar in San Dimas

For many readers, the decision of which solar company to choose comes down to total costs.The installation cost is just one important factor you should bear in mind when looking into getting solar panels. How much it'll cost and how much you can save depend on things such as:

  • Incentives: The federal solar investment tax credit currently allows you to lower your taxes by 0 of the project cost. Your state and city may also have incentives and rebates that you can take advantage of. In addition, you can save about $25,000 over 20 years on your utility bills, without incentives.
  • The amount of sunlight your roof gets: If your rooftop doesn’t see much direct sunlight, your solar panels won’t be able to produce as much energy, which will leave you with lower savings on energy bills than someone with a roof that gets a lot of sunlight.
  • System size and type: Some models are more expensive than others, so the one you want to get can raise or lower your initial investment. Plus, the more solar panels you need, the more it'll cost.
  • How much energy you use: If your home regularly uses a lot of energy, you'll reap more rewards from switching to solar.

Thanks to solar panels decreasing in cost as well as several solar incentives, they are a sound investment for most homeowners.

What are the main advantages and disadvantages of installing solar panels?

A few of the biggest pros are that it lowers your electricity bills, it’s environmentally friendly, and it can give you a decent return on your investment (ROI). The most notable cons are that solar panels don’t produce electricity at night, the installation cost is pricey and solar panels aren’t always aesthetically pleasing.

Is it worth putting solar panels on my house?

Solar panels can be a great investment for lots of homeowners, but truthfully, they might not be worth it for everyone. If your home doesn't get enough sunlight or your power bills are already reasonably low, solar panels might not be for you.

How much solar panel capacity do I need for my house?

Solar panel capacity is rated based on how many watts of power they generate under standard testing conditions. Since each panel can generally produce about 250 to 400 watts per hour, the average household will need 20 to 35 panels.
